Understanding Pepper Spray: Types and Effectiveness
Pepper spray, a potent irritant, has long been a staple in riot control and self-defense applications. Understanding its various types and delivery methods is crucial when considering its effectiveness as a law enforcement tool or personal safety measure. The most common forms include aerosol cans, hand-held devices resembling small guns, and handheld dispensers that emit a stream of concentrated spray.
Each method has its advantages; for instance, aerosol cans provide broad coverage but require proper aim, while handheld devices offer greater accuracy over shorter distances. Best Pepper Spray Delivery Methods often depend on the specific scenario: tactical operations may favor precision-aimed devices for targeted neutralization, whereas crowd control situations might benefit from the wider reach of aerosols. Knowing these nuances ensures that users can select the most suitable pepper spray delivery system for their needs.
Design and Functionality of Riot Control Dispensers
Riot control dispensers are designed to effectively deploy pepper spray or other irritants during chaotic situations, making them key tools for law enforcement and security personnel. These devices typically feature a robust build to withstand harsh conditions, with various designs catering to different deployment scenarios. Some models use handheld triggers, allowing officers to aim precisely at specific targets, while others employ automatic mechanisms for rapid, wide-area coverage. The functionality focuses on delivering a powerful yet controlled stream of pepper spray, ensuring maximum impact without endangering bystanders or friendly forces.
The best pepper spray delivery methods incorporate advanced features like adjustable spray patterns and ranges, allowing operators to adapt to diverse environments. Modern dispensers often include safety mechanisms to prevent accidental activation and reduce collateral damage, enhancing the overall effectiveness and safety of riot control operations. These innovative designs play a crucial role in managing public disturbances, offering a strategic advantage in maintaining order and ensuring the safety of both civilians and law enforcement officers.
Safety, Training, and Ethical Considerations for Use
When discussing the safety aspects of using an inflammatory riot control spray dispenser, it’s crucial to emphasize that best pepper spray delivery methods should always prioritize minimizing harm and adhering to legal guidelines. The primary concern lies in ensuring the safety of both users and bystanders, as these devices can cause significant irritation and temporary incapacitation. Proper training is indispensable; law enforcement officers or individuals authorized to use such equipment must undergo comprehensive instruction on its correct deployment to avoid excessive force and potential injuries.
Ethical considerations further underscore the responsibility associated with carrying and utilizing inflammatory riot control spray. Use of force should be a last resort, and operators must be vigilant in assessing situations to prevent unnecessary spraying, especially in crowded areas. Regular reviews of policies and procedures can help maintain accountability and ensure that the use of such devices aligns with ethical standards and respects human rights while effectively addressing civil unrest or violent encounters.
